Job Description
Bengaluru, Gurugram - Location
Shift - 1 pm IST to 10 pm IST
Core Job Functions/Responsibilities:
Work in a team of dedicated analysts supporting a London based commercial real estate loan asset management team for a top 5 global private equity client, working on their European book (approx. 70 loans - a mix of construction, operating and investment loans).
Communicate deal information and adhere to appropriate workflows.
Work in a dynamic team environment and participate in strategic initiatives identifying and implementing best practices and operational efficiencies.
Work closely with the AM teams mainly in Europe, with some collaboration with US and India teams.
Provide analysis, recommendations and reporting support to individual London based asset managers on their allocation of loans (e.g. construction draw recommendations, internal reporting templates, quarterly asset reviews, lease consent analysis).
Interpret and analyse documentation to understand and extract key loan terms and monitor covenants, triggers, events and milestones.
Analyse Rent Roll data to calculate financial metrics (e.g. DY, DSCR, NOI, occupancy).
Ensure accurate dataflow maintained on the loan asset management system.
Maintain balance, interest & hedging schedules and manage reconciliations with operations teams.
Manage ad-hoc requests on loan portfolio and special projects from London based asset management team.
Qualifications/ Requirements:
Minimum of 2 years of UK & European commercial real estate experience in a lending, servicing, or asset management platform.
Strong academic background: MBA or CFA level 1 preferred.
Effective communication (written and oral) skills with comfort communicating with all levels of both internal and external teams. [Fluent English speaker.]
Experience with loan asset management systems (such as Real INSIGHT) is a benefit.
High standard of proficiency navigating legal documentation (e.g. Guarantees). LMA experience is a benefit.
High standard of numerical and excel skills, e.g. cash flow modelling, calculating IRRs and debt service.
Experience working with multiple loan operations teams for funding & reconciliation processes.
Excellent organizational skills.
Shift flexibility aligning with London IST and ability to remote work where/when necessary.
